  Achievements and Awards

Listed as one of the top 25 business schools for entrepreneurs, Success magazine. 1994 and 1995
(top 35 - 1996, 1997, top 50 -2001)

Award for best entrepreneurship education (Best teaching practices) in National competition with eight other universities, by USASBE. February 2001.

Las Americas hall of Fame Award for outstanding contributions to the small business community, for helping to build Washington, DC's inner city, and for improving the social economic conditions in low income neighborhoods. April 2001.

Greater Washington Entrepreneur of the Year, June 1999. Awarded by Ernst & Young. One of three finalists at National level. November 1999.

Greater Washington entrepreneur of the Year - Finalist - 1997. Ernst & Young.

Elevated to Ernst & Young's Entrepreneur of the Year Hall of Fame as a lifetime member. November 1999.

National Model Undergraduate program Award. 2nd place, USASBE, 2000 Program. Was a finalist in 1998.

Received award for "The Best Entrepreneurial MBA Program". GWU was the only recipient of the award in the country. Presented by the United States Association for Small Business and Entrepreneurship (USASBE). 1996.

Award for Best Innovation in the Classroom. USASBE, 1998.
